Understanding your Retirement Options

Understanding your retirement options can be a complex and daunting task. There is a number of elements that will impact your retirement options and everyone is different. It is important to have a personalised strategy to help you understand what income you need in retirement, how many assets and the most tax effective way to structure your financial affairs. Buying your first home - some tips

Here is a really practical article in Money Management on things to think about when you buy your first home.

Buying your first home is exciting, but it’s important to think with your head and not just your heart. If you’re considering taking the leap the first step is working out how much you can afford. This depends partly on how much deposit you have saved up. You’ll probably need at least 5% percent to 10 percent ...
